Subject: [U-Boot] Kirkwood: no console messages from init_sequence?
Date: Mon, 18 Oct 2010 15:35:27 -0400	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20101018193527.GA21492@localhost>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20101018004031.GC22934@localhost>

On Sun, Oct 17, 2010 at 08:40:31PM -0400, Eric Cooper wrote:
> I no longer see any of the early console messages that should result
> from display_banner, print_cpuinfo, etc.  The first thing I see is the
> NAND information:
> [...]

But if I load the same u-boot image into memory and execute it with
"go", I see the entire banner, DRAM message, etc.  So the problem only
occurs when it is booting from NAND flash.
